got my mavic cxp-22/formulas for $145 from bicyclewheelwarehouse.com. shipped quickly and i haven't had to true them once, with 5 months of hard riding and crap-tastic streets. also came with a 15t cog and a formula lockring, and rim tape. wasn't expecting those "extras".

for tires, check out probikekit.com. i got my girlfriend's tires for $10 a piece, and they come in colors. some cheap michelins. they are not thick, so not great for skidding, but they do skid easily enough. time will tell if they are durable. she still can't skid, so its not a huge issue for her yet.
